Fucking up logistics. If they have 10000 men then they need food for that many, transport, gear and such. If you go for quantity over quality you end up needing big logistics. If your 5 shitty tanks equal 1 good tank you still need 5 times the fuel, maintenance, ammo and crew. Kinda why quality usually beats quantity. A million drones you also don't magically pull out of your ass, there is a large support element you can fuck with.

>historically
Fortifications and missile weaponry or firearms when your enemy lacks such things. Basically see Rorke's drift. Additionally, numerical superiority becomes a liability when your supply lines are vulnerable, as greater numbers demand greater logistical capacity to keep them supplied, which presents a bigger target.

>modern
Air power, space power (i.e. satellites), machine guns, artillery, armour, and as boring and ghey as they are, drones. Logistics being more important than ever in modern warfare means attacking enemy supply capacity is more efficacious.
